Mesoscale Discussion 1900
NWS Storm Prediction Center Norman OK
0300 PM CDT Wed Aug 14 2024

Areas affected...Portions of the TX/OK Panhandles...far northwest
OK...and south-central KS

Concerning...Severe potential...Watch unlikely

Valid 142000Z - 142200Z

Probability of Watch Issuance...20 percent

SUMMARY...Isolated strong/severe downbursts are possible through the
afternoon, though a watch is not expected here. The severe threat
will increase later this afternoon/evening with northeastward
extent.

DISCUSSION...Boundary-layer cumulus is gradually deepening along a
pre-frontal heat axis/confluence zone extending from the TX
Panhandle northeastward into south-central KS. Over the TX
Panhandle, cumulus is deeper and isolated convective initiation is
underway. During the next few hours, continued
heating/destabilization should aid in isolated to widely scattered
high-based thunderstorms along the heat axis, and potentially along
a slow-moving cold front over southwest KS. Surface temperatures
climbing into the upper 90s/lower 100s and associated steep
low-level lapse rates will support strong to locally severe
downbursts with any high-based storms that can initiate through the
afternoon. Modest deep-layer flow/shear (especially from the TX
Panhandle into south-central KS) should generally limit storm
longevity, and generally weak large-scale ascent casts uncertainty
on overall storm coverage. Therefore, a watch is not expected for
this area.

Both instability and deep-layer wind shear increase with
northeastward extent into central/northeast KS, and any storms that
spread/develop into this area will pose a greater severe threat
later this afternoon into the evening.
